Donner Springs is an established neighborhood about five miles southeast of Downtown Reno at the base of Rattlesnake Mountain, long appreciated by locals for its quiet, tree-lined streets and central Southeast location.

Housing is mostly moderately priced single-family homes built primarily from the 1960s through the 1980s — quiet tract residences on flat, bikeable streets. Most homes carry no HOA, and lot sizes are consistent across the established blocks.

The location is one of the flattest and most bikeable in the region and sits close to Meadowood Mall, South Meadows, Rosewood Lakes and Hidden Valley golf courses, and major employers. Schools fall under the Washoe County School District, and detailed neighborhood data for this district is being expanded.
